云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

Vue.js 是一個(gè)流行的前端 JavaScript 框架,由尤雨溪?jiǎng)?chuàng)建,它被廣泛用于開(kāi)發(fā)單頁(yè)面應(yīng)用程序(SPAs)和復(fù)雜的用戶界面。黃石Vue.js 是指 Vue.js 的一個(gè)特定版本,可能指的是某個(gè)特定版本的 Vue.js 或者是一個(gè)基于 Vue.js 的定制版本。由于我沒(méi)有具體的信息來(lái)確定黃石Vue.js 指的是什么,我將討論一般意義上的 Vue.js 在網(wǎng)站開(kāi)發(fā)中的優(yōu)勢(shì)。
Vue.js 的優(yōu)勢(shì)主要包括以下幾個(gè)方面:
1. **簡(jiǎn)單易學(xué)**:Vue.js 的學(xué)習(xí)曲線相對(duì)平緩,對(duì)于初學(xué)者來(lái)說(shuō),它比 Angular 和 React 等其他框架更容易上手。它的 API 設(shè)計(jì)直觀,文檔清晰,有很多資源可以幫助開(kāi)發(fā)者快速入門。
2. **漸進(jìn)式框架**:Vue.js 是一個(gè)漸進(jìn)式框架,這意味著你可以逐步采用它,而不需要一次性替換整個(gè)應(yīng)用程序。你可以只使用 Vue.js 的視圖層,或者隨著應(yīng)用程序的增長(zhǎng)逐漸引入更多的功能。
3. **性能和響應(yīng)性**:Vue.js 使用虛擬 DOM 來(lái)優(yōu)化性能,并提供響應(yīng)式數(shù)據(jù)綁定,確保當(dāng)數(shù)據(jù)發(fā)生變化時(shí),視圖會(huì)自動(dòng)更新。
4. **組合式視圖組件**:Vue.js 允許你創(chuàng)建可重用的組合式視圖組件,這有助于提高代碼的模塊化和可維護(hù)性。
5. **強(qiáng)大的生態(tài)系統(tǒng)**:Vue.js 有一個(gè)龐大的生態(tài)系統(tǒng),包括大量的插件、庫(kù)和工具,這些可以擴(kuò)展 Vue.js 的功能,幫助開(kāi)發(fā)者更高效地開(kāi)發(fā)和維護(hù)應(yīng)用程序。
6. **社區(qū)支持和資源**:Vue.js 有一個(gè)活躍的社區(qū),提供了大量的資源、教程、工具和庫(kù),這些都有助于開(kāi)發(fā)者更好地使用 Vue.js。
7. **與現(xiàn)有項(xiàng)目集成**:Vue.js 可以很容易地與現(xiàn)有的項(xiàng)目集成,因?yàn)樗w積小,而且可以只包含必要的功能。
8. **狀態(tài)管理**:Vue.js 提供了多種狀態(tài)管理方案,如 Vuex,它可以幫助開(kāi)發(fā)者更好地管理復(fù)雜的狀態(tài),特別是在大型應(yīng)用程序中。
9. **路由和打包**:Vue.js 可以與 Vue Router 結(jié)合使用,實(shí)現(xiàn)單頁(yè)面應(yīng)用程序的路由功能,并且可以與 Webpack 等工具一起使用,進(jìn)行代碼的打包和模塊化。
10. **開(kāi)發(fā)體驗(yàn)**:Vue.js 提供了良好的開(kāi)發(fā)體驗(yàn),如基于組件的開(kāi)發(fā)、調(diào)試工具、熱模塊替換(HMR)等,這些都有助于提高開(kāi)發(fā)效率。
請(qǐng)注意,如果黃石Vue.js 指的是一個(gè)特定的版本或者定制版本,那么它的優(yōu)勢(shì)可能會(huì)有所不同,需要根據(jù)具體的情況來(lái)評(píng)估。